【友盟+】开发者社区

Facebook第三方登录无法一次性拿到用户数据

膜拜2222222 发表于 2016-12-24 09:38:42 |

膜拜2222222
膜拜2222222 发表于 2016-12-22 16:28:28 | 显示全部楼层 |阅读模式
比如我给按钮设置一个点击事件,点击后调用getPlatformInfo(final Activity context, final SHARE_MEDIA platform, final UMAuthListener listener)
方法,结果跳转到Facebook登录页面输入完后跳转回来,listener的方法始终没有回调,我再次点按钮就能拿到数据,我在Activity的 onActivityResult(int requestCode, int resultCode, Intent data)
中也添加了UMShareAPI.get(this).onActivityResult(requestCode, resultCode, data);目前用微信、QQ、Twitter都能一次登录
成功,而Facebook需要点击两次



输入邮箱密码

输入邮箱密码

授权成功

授权成功

授权后回到该页面,但始终没有响应

授权后回到该页面,但始终没有响应

再次点击获取才有数据

再次点击获取才有数据



上一篇:微信分享黑框问题
下一篇:ios微信分享成功返回程序显示空白页




您需要登录后才可以发帖 登录 | 立即注册

本版积分规则

发表主题

精彩推荐

分享成功后返回无效
我分享成功之后,出现这样的界面,而且点击返回按钮无效,返回按钮的名字也不对。
Unable to convert classes into dex format.
Unable to convert classes into dex format. 直接导入的Unity包,结果一直这样。删了很多了,还是这
【报错必看】crash提示缺少资源文件……
当你有如下提示的时候,说明你缺少对应的资源文件, 根据提示,缺少资源文件:packageName=com.umeng.soe

关注我们

新浪微博
微信

欢迎关注友盟官方微博微信!

在线客服
返回顶部 返回列表